Cecil Dam #1

Cecil Dam #1 is an earth dam located in Guilford County, North Carolina, built in 1968. It carries a Low hazard potential classification.

About Cecil Dam #1

The primary purpose of Cecil Dam #1 is recreation. The dam creates a reservoir used for recreational activities such as fishing, boating, and swimming. The dam is owned by Ervin R Cecil (private). It impounds the Ut To Richland Creek near Randleman.

The dam stands 23 feet tall and stretches 380 feet across, creates a reservoir covering 9 acres, has a maximum storage capacity of 84 acre-feet, and collects water from a drainage area of 0 square miles. Completed in 1968, the structure is well into its service life at over 50 years old.

This dam has a low hazard potential classification, meaning that failure would cause minimal damage, limited primarily to the dam owner's property, with no expected loss of life. The most recent inspection on record was 01/06/2025.
